What is Douglas County Property Worth?
How much will I get per acre in Douglas County? What's the price per acre near me? How much is land bringing near Ava? Wasola? Mansfield? We hear it all the time. It's a loaded question, though. No 2 properties are alike. How much timber is on the property? Pasture? What condition is the timber or pasture? Is there live water? Seasonal water? Ponds? Is there power available? Rural water? A well? Is it on pavement? Gravel? How far are you from amenities? How is the terrain? How big is the parcel?
There are so many ways that a property can vary... all of which goes into consideration when pricing land. These days, prices range from $2,000 an acre to $10,000 depending on all of these factors. Missouri is a non-disclosure state, so sale prices are not public data. The best way to price your property is to have a lincensed real esatate agent that has access to comparables (sold properties) and sells land as their specialty.
